Anatomy of the Bladder: A Closer Look

The bladder is a hollow, muscular organ located in the pelvis, just behind the pubic bone. Plus, its size and shape vary depending on how full it is. When empty, it's relatively small and pear-shaped; when full, it can expand significantly to accommodate a considerable volume of urine.

Several key anatomical features contribute to the bladder's function:

  • Detrusor Muscle: This is the smooth muscle that forms the majority of the bladder wall. Its ability to contract and relax is essential for urine storage and emptying. The detrusor muscle is innervated by both the sympathetic and parasympathetic nervous systems, allowing for finely tuned control.

  • Trigone: This is a triangular area at the base of the bladder, formed by the openings of the two ureters (which bring urine from the kidneys) and the urethra (which carries urine out of the body). The trigone is composed of smooth muscle that is less distensible than the rest of the bladder wall, helping to prevent urine reflux (backward flow) into the ureters.

  • Internal Urethral Sphincter: This is a ring of smooth muscle located at the junction of the bladder and urethra. It is involuntarily controlled and remains contracted to prevent the involuntary leakage of urine.

  • External Urethral Sphincter: This is a ring of skeletal muscle that surrounds the urethra just below the internal sphincter. It's under voluntary control, allowing us to consciously control urination.

  • Urethra: This is the tube that carries urine from the bladder to the outside of the body. The length and position of the urethra differ between males and females, contributing to differences in urinary tract infections (UTIs).

Physiology of the Bladder: The Micturition Reflex

The process of urine elimination, known as micturition, is a complex interplay of neural and muscular events. Here’s a breakdown:

  1. Urine Accumulation: As urine is produced by the kidneys, it flows down the ureters into the bladder. The bladder gradually fills, causing its walls to stretch. Specialized stretch receptors within the bladder wall detect this distension.

  2. Sensory Input: The stretch receptors send signals via sensory nerves to the sacral spinal cord. As the bladder fills, the frequency of these signals increases.

  3. Micturition Reflex Initiation: When the bladder reaches a certain level of fullness (typically around 200-400 mL), the micturition reflex is triggered. This reflex involves parasympathetic stimulation of the detrusor muscle, causing it to contract rhythmically. Simultaneously, the internal urethral sphincter relaxes.

  4. Conscious Control: At this point, the individual becomes aware of the urge to urinate. The external urethral sphincter, under voluntary control, can either be relaxed, allowing urination to occur, or remain contracted, delaying urination.

  5. Urination: Once the external urethral sphincter is relaxed, urine flows from the bladder through the urethra and out of the body.

Common Bladder Issues and Conditions

Several conditions can affect the bladder's function, leading to discomfort and potentially serious health problems:

  • Urinary Tract Infections (UTIs): These are infections of the urinary tract, often affecting the bladder. Symptoms include frequent urination, burning sensation during urination, and cloudy urine.

  • Overactive Bladder (OAB): This condition is characterized by a sudden, strong urge to urinate, often leading to urinary urgency and frequency. It can significantly impact quality of life.

  • Urinary Incontinence: This is the involuntary leakage of urine. Various types of incontinence exist, including stress incontinence, urge incontinence, and mixed incontinence.

  • Bladder Stones: These are hard deposits that can form in the bladder, often due to mineral buildup. They can cause pain, bleeding, and difficulty urinating.

  • Bladder Cancer: This is a serious condition that requires prompt medical attention. Symptoms can include blood in the urine, pelvic pain, and frequent urination.

Frequently Asked Questions (FAQ)

Q: How much urine can the bladder hold?

A: The bladder's capacity varies, but it can typically hold around 400-600 mL of urine before the urge to urinate becomes strong. Still, some individuals can hold significantly more or less.

Q: Why do I need to urinate more frequently at night?

A: Nocturia, or the need to urinate frequently at night, can be caused by several factors, including aging, certain medications, and underlying medical conditions like diabetes or prostate enlargement.

Q: What are the symptoms of a bladder infection?

A: Symptoms of a bladder infection (UTI) typically include frequent urination, a burning sensation during urination, cloudy or foul-smelling urine, and sometimes pelvic pain.

Q: How can I improve my bladder health?

A: Maintaining good bladder health involves staying hydrated, practicing good hygiene, avoiding bladder irritants like caffeine and alcohol, and strengthening pelvic floor muscles through Kegel exercises.

Q: When should I see a doctor about bladder problems?
